The Relationship Between Superstitious Beliefs, Information Processing Styles and Sense of Agency among People Going to Fortuneteller
Researches have shown that information processing styles are important determination for superstitious beliefs and superstitious people have less sense of control on their destination. The purpose of this study was to investigate relationship between superstitious beliefs, information processing styles and sense of agency among people going to fortuneteller.
The research design is descriptive-correlational. The statistical population includes 425 people that going to fortuneteller in Urmia. The sample of study is 200 people that sselsected by available sampling method.. To collect information, Information Process Styles questionnaire of Epstein and Pacini (1999), superstitious belief questionnaire (2019) and The sense of agency rating scale (2013), were used. for data analyzing, the pearson correlation and multivariable regression were used
The results showed that there was a Negative and significant relationship between the rationalism information process, sense of agency with superstitious beliefs, and The positive significant relationship between the intuitionalism information process and superstitious beliefs. regression analysis showed that all of them predicted significantly the superstitious beliefs(P <0/01).
Considering the significant relationship between superstitious beliefs, information processing styles and sense of agency, the results of this study have implications for reducing of superstitious and fortunetelling expansion in society.
